Today, we'll talk about the four steps I'd take if I needed to start a startup in 2025. We'll also talk about idiots.
We begin by embracing the reality that both founders and customers are irrational. Then, we build out steps and a process to address this. We start with a life audit, increase our Luck Surface Area, tackle the unit economics of working with one customer, and build out a system for accountability. This is a fun episode - one of my favorites in a while.
